Nettet22. mar. 2024 · In addition to visual inspections, you can also tell that a goat’s hooves need to be trimmed if they start having difficulty walking or standing. If their hooves are too long, they will have trouble balancing and could even start limping. Nettet17. feb. 2024 · How Often Do Sheep and Goats Need to Be Trimmed? In general, a sheep needs its hooves trimmed every six to ten weeks. It varies depending on the terrain, the time of the year, the age, and the individual sheep’s natural tendencies.
